The latest semi-annual release of LibreOffice, the cross-platform FOSS office suite, is out – and it’s gleefully throwing some shade. The Document Foundation released LibreOffice 26.8 – and sent The Register a press pack before it did so. We’re not going to go through it in great depth: it’s a mature suite, and most Linux distros bundle it by default, even some of the slightly strange ones.
